Cold weather will also have an influence in consumption as much more energy is being used (wipers, heater, lights and so forth) so this will adjust slightly from summer season to winter.Utilizing position B has the impact of engine braking and can be employed when descending a hill, for instance. We don't advise you leave the automobile in B for standard driving as this can use more fuel over time. The engine will execute better when it is at its optimum temperature, for that reason on a warmer day you are probably to accomplish a slightly far better MPG figure. A colder engine requires time to warm up and for the duration of this time it is not running at its optimum efficiency. We hope this helps to clarify how the outdoors temperature can affect the car's MPG.
